Have I got an amplifier for you!
How about a nice Heathkit Warrior amplifier? I got a couple of hundred
watts out with the one I used to have. Ran fine, no snap crackle, pop or
mysterious noise that sometimes come out of the SB 220.
Built like a brick Pagoda too.

> Hi George,
> well if you really want a great match for the DX-100, you might look into
> getting
> a class "B" 4-1000A amplifier. The DX-100 drives them well 160 - 10
> meters.
> Keeping in mind that this would be a homebrew affair. Or you could look
> around
> for one of the Henry Radio 2 KWamps, they can handle the DX-100 nicely,
> also are grounded grid as well. FWIW, and as always YMMV.

>> Hi Guys..
>> I have been planning my AM station, I have a Heathkit DX-100 and a
>> HQ-180,
>> I have been putting a Heathkit SB-220 back together and now its ready to
>> go, But i been told its not good for AM.
>> Since AM is my plan what does one look for, I have a Johnson Thunderbolt
>> ,Offered Needs a going over been setting for my years but price is
>> $300.oo.i n nice looking condition.
>> any other thoughts.
